rear street lynx kit went in easily . Bill was very helpful , car now has a ford 9 inch rear end with 3:75 gears because the owner didn't car if it was all Chrysler , and is a blast to drive. it has the front altercation as well and drives like a go cart i recommend his products for any one who does not mind altering their car in this manner. It is a great improvement over original cars with drum brake/steering box set ups
